Graphene and Heat Conduction: A Four-Phonon Scattering Investigation
Graphene, a material composed of a single layer of carbon atoms, often hailed as the "Next big thing" in material science, may not possess as revolutionary thermal properties as initially believed, according to findings from researchers at Purdue University.
